The meaning of Onderdonk

Flemish and Dutch: variant, mostly Americanized, of Onderdonck, a topographic name composed of onder ‘below, under, lower’ + donk ‘small hill’.

How common is the last name Onderdonk in the United States?

The surname Onderdonk was ranked 42,437 in popularity in 2000 and dropped slightly to 42,511 in 2010, as reflected in the Decennial U.S. Census data. The count of people with this surname increased by 6.03% from 481 in 2000 to 510 in 2010. Despite this increase in numbers, the proportion of the Onderdonk surname per 100,000 people saw a decrease of 5.56%, dropping from 0.18 to 0.17.

Race and Ethnicity of people with the last name Onderdonk

Drawing from the Decennial U.S. Census, the Onderdonk surname is predominantly associated with individuals identifying as white, which accounted for 93.14% in 2010, decreasing slightly from 94.80% in 2000. People who identified as Hispanic increased significantly from 1.25% to 3.14%. Those identifying as Asian/Pacific Islander decreased from 1.25% to 0.98%, and individuals claiming two or more races increased from 1.25% to 2.35%. There were no individuals with the Onderdonk surname who identified as Black in either 2000 or 2010, and no one identified as American Indian and Alaskan Native in 2010, while they constituted 1.46% in 2000.
